AsExpressreported, Eugenie initially welcomed Meghan into the family as she is said to be very close with Harry.
She even “told friends she loved Meghan,” and thought she was perfect for Harry.

However, Meghan may have breached protocol when she chose Eugenie’s wedding day to announce her pregnancy.
Fortunately, Eugenie and Meghan appear to have mended things since that poorly timed pregnancy announcement!
They’ve reportedly been friendly and have even “bonded” over their pregnancies, according toUs Weekly.
